Sugar Hill has two new feathered friends and is seeking help to name them. Residents may remember George the Duck who lived in Sugar Hill a year ago. Despite his demise, two new Peking ducks have waddled into the city and are ready for their own Instagram fame.

To participate, visit www.cityofsugarhill.com/help-name-the-new-downtown-ducks/. Download and print the duck coloring page. Color the page and fill in the nametags with your favorite and most creative duck names. Turn your coloring page in at City Hall, 5039 West Broad St. Look for duck boxes near customer service and the post office to submit your entry.

Deadline for entries is July 8.
